Workshops and
Curriculum
Thinking

People typically reach out to me with a broad question, such as:

James! Can you visit our school and help us make trigonometry (or fractions, logarithms, the area model—any school math topic) meaningful and joyful for everyone?

And I do my best to answer YES!

But to be clear, the work we do together will be to roll up our sleeves and do genuine mathematics together. We’ll explore why humans were inspired to engage with the topic in the first place, we’ll strip away the curriculum clutter that obscures the simple, natural, and common-sense thinking behind it, and bring joy, meaning, purpose, ease, and kindness to the student experience.

In short: We won’t just talk about doing math—we’ll do math!

Most Popular Topics:

  • Exploding Dots: The story of place value throughout the entire curriculum, and beyond!
  • Quadratics: Their algebra and their graphs
  • Trigonometry
  • Fractions: How to help high schoolers
  • Patterns: What to do if you trust them; What to do if you don’t!
  • Exponents and Logarithms
  • Proportional Reasoning
